Overview of the Products

In the realm of CPU coolers, the Intel i3/i5/i7 LGA115x CPU Heatsink by ZYZMOON and the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 Ultra White CPU Cooler present two distinct options catering to different user needs and budgets. The Intel cooler is priced at C$19.99, making it an economical choice, while the Thermalright cooler is significantly more expensive at C$95.14. This price difference reflects the varying features and performance capacities of each product.

Design and Build Quality

The design of a CPU cooler significantly affects its cooling performance and aesthetics. The Intel i3/i5/i7 LGA115x CPU Heatsink features an aluminum heatsink that is lightweight and easy to install with a tool-free push pin mechanism. In contrast, the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 Ultra White boasts a more sophisticated build with a combination of aluminum and copper materials. Its twin tower radiator design and seven heat pipes enhance the overall heat dissipation capability, making it suitable for users who demand higher performance from their cooling solutions.

Cooling Performance

Cooling performance is crucial for maintaining optimal CPU temperatures during intensive tasks. The Intel cooler is designed for CPUs with a thermal design power (TDP) of up to 65W, providing adequate cooling for entry-level processors. On the other hand, the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 features advanced technology with seven heat pipes and a design to efficiently manage heat dissipation. This cooler is engineered to handle more demanding CPUs, making it a better fit for users with high-performance requirements.

Compatibility

Both coolers offer broad compatibility; however, they cater to slightly different user bases. The Intel i3/i5/i7 LGA115x CPU Heatsink is specifically designed for Intel's LGA115x socket series, including LGA 1150, 1151, 1155, and 1156. Meanwhile, the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 supports a wider range of Intel and AMD platforms, including LGA1700 and AM4/AM5 sockets. This versatility allows the Thermalright cooler to appeal to a broader audience and those who may consider switching platforms in the future.

Noise Levels

Noise levels are an essential consideration for many PC builders. The Intel i3/i5/i7 LGA115x CPU Heatsink operates with a 4-pin PWM power connector, which allows for adjustable fan speeds and noise levels. However, specific noise levels are not provided in its specifications. In contrast, the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 is designed with S-FDB V2.0 bearings that help minimize noise while maximizing cooling performance. With an operating noise level of less than 28.3 dB(A), it offers a quieter operation, making it a suitable choice for users prioritizing a silent PC experience.

Installation Process

The installation process can greatly affect the user experience when setting up a new cooler. The Intel i3/i5/i7 LGA115x CPU Heatsink is lauded for its easy, tool-free push pin installation, making it accessible for novice builders or those looking for a quick upgrade. In contrast, the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 requires a more involved installation process, with detailed instructions and mounting grommets provided. While it may be more complex, this cooler’s design allows for better performance, justifying the additional effort required for installation.

Which should you buy?

In summary, the choice between the Intel i3/i5/i7 LGA115x CPU Heatsink and the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 Ultra White CPU Cooler ultimately depends on your specific needs and budget. If you are looking for an economical solution for lower TDP CPUs and easy installation, the Intel cooler is an excellent choice. However, if you require superior cooling performance and compatibility with both Intel and AMD platforms, the Thermalright Royal Pretor 130 is worth the investment for its advanced features and better cooling efficiency.
